Strickberger's evolution : the integration of genes, organisms and populations / Brian K. Hall, Benedikt Hallgrimsson.

Contents:
PART 1: THE HISTORICAL FRAMEWORK: EVOLUTION AS SCIENCE: Before Darwin -- Darwin and natural selection -- The arguments and the evidence for evolution -- PART 2: ORIGINS: THE ENORMITY OF TIME: The origins of cosmic structures and chemical elements -- Origin of Earth -- Molecules, protocells and natural selection -- From molecules to life -- Origins of ciells and the first organisms -- PART 3:THE ORGANIC FRAMEWORK: GENES CELLS AND DEVELOPMENT: Cell division, Mendelian genetics, and sex determination -- Chromosomes, mutation, gene regulation and variation -- Species, phylogeny and classification -- Genes and phylo genetic relationships -- Genes, development and evolution -- PART 4: THE ORGANISMS: THE DIVERSITY OF LIFE: Evolution of plants and fungi -- Animals and their origin -- Evolution among the invertebrates -- Chordate and vertebrate origins -- From water to land to air: amphibians and amniotes -- Evolution of mammals -- Primate evolution and the human origins -- PART 5: POPULATION AND SPECIATION: CHANGES WITHIN AND BETWEEN SPECIES: Populations and speciation: changes within and between species -- Populations, gene frequencies and equilibrium -- Changes to gene frequencies -- Structure and maintenance of populations -- From populations to species -- PART 6: EVOLUTION AND SOCIETY: PAST, PRESENT AND FUTURE; SOCIETY AND RELIGION: Cultural and human-directed evolution -- Belief, religion and evolution -- Glossary.
